Call for Tinubu to Rename INEC HQ in Honor of Election Hero Nwosu
Mar 27, 2025 / 0 Comments
Elder statesman Chekwas Okorie has asked President Bola Tinubu to commemorate Professor Humphrey Nwosu by renaming the INEC headquarters. Nwosu oversaw Nigeria's fairest election in 1993, declaring MKO Abiola the winner despite facing political threats. While Abiola received posthumous honors, Nwosu was largely unrecognized. Okorie's appeal aims to cement Nwosu’s legacy in Nigeria’s democratic history.
